Overview

HORNELL JUNIOR-SENIOR HIGH SCHOOL is a public high serving grades 7–12 in HORNELL, New York. The school enrolls 608 students. It is part of the HORNELL CITY SCHOOL DISTRICT district.

Equity & Title I

In the United States, Free/Reduced Lunch (FRL) eligibility is the primary federal proxy for student poverty. Schools with 40% or more FRL-eligible students typically qualify for Title I school-wide programs.
